When To Consult a Cosmetic Dentist About Cosmetic Dental Treatments
Cosmetic dental treatments can bring you closer to the smile of your dreams. The main focus of these services is to enhance the appearance of the smile, which in turn boosts confidence. They can even make oral hygiene and care easier, although that is not the primary purpose. Knowing when it is time to consult a cosmetic dentist for these services can help you reach your smile goals without unnecessary delays.
When should you consult a cosmetic dentist?
A consultation with a cosmetic dentist is a good idea whenever patients have concerns about how their smile looks. This is particularly the case when the teeth, gums, or overall smile begin to affect personal or professional confidence. While cosmetic dentistry is often associated with elective procedures, some treatments bring long-term functional benefits, as well. A common example is straightening teeth, which can also improve bite function, reduce jaw tension, and make brushing and flossing easier.
A few common signs that suggest the need for a cosmetic dental consultation include visible tooth discoloration, enamel cracks or chips, gaps between teeth, gummy smiles, or asymmetrical features. Others may feel self-conscious due to uneven teeth, excessive wear, or an outdated dental restoration that no longer looks natural. Additionally, patients preparing for significant life events — weddings or public-facing roles — frequently turn to cosmetic dental treatments to achieve a refined, photo-ready smile. After all, even subtle enhancements can make a meaningful impact on overall facial appearance and self-confidence.
Cosmetic dental treatments to consider
Cosmetic dental treatments encompass a wide range of services tailored to meet patient goals. However, most fall into two categories:
Tooth-altering treatments
Tooth-altering cosmetic dental treatments modify the shape, color, or surface of the teeth to create a more symmetrical and attractive smile. Popular procedures in this category include dental veneers, bonding, and professional teeth whitening.
Dental veneers are thin shells that dentists custom-make and bond to the front of teeth. They can conceal chips, cracks, gaps, and discoloration while maintaining a natural appearance. For a less invasive option, consider composite bonding. This treatment uses a tooth-colored resin to reshape or repair teeth with minimal enamel removal. Alternatively, for those dealing primarily with discoloration, teeth whitening offers dramatic, safe, and fast-acting results compared to over-the-counter options.
Enamel contouring and reshaping may also be ideal for patients with slightly uneven or overly prominent teeth. Through these minimally invasive treatments, a dentist creates smoother lines and a more balanced smile profile.
Gum-related services
Cosmetic dental treatments extend beyond the teeth themselves. Gums play an important role in framing the smile and maintaining oral balance. When excess gum tissue creates a gummy smile or uneven gum lines disrupt the general appearance of the smile, cosmetic dentists may recommend gum contouring or laser gum reshaping.
Gum contouring involves carefully sculpting the gum line to expose more of the tooth structure, creating a harmonious proportion between teeth and gums. However, for patients with receding gums, tissue grafting may restore a healthy appearance and protect tooth roots. These procedures can also enhance overall oral hygiene by making teeth easier to clean and reducing areas where bacteria may build up.
What to expect at a consultation with a cosmetic dentist
The consultation process begins with a comprehensive examination, including digital imaging, dental X-rays, and a discussion of aesthetic concerns. The cosmetic dentist, who may also work as a family or general dentist, evaluates tooth alignment, color, symmetry, and gum health to identify opportunities for improvement. They may also utilize digital smile design or 3D mockups to preview potential results with the patient before starting treatment.
Keep in mind that every cosmetic dental treatment is different, especially once adapted to a patient’s needs and goals. Patients can ask further questions about the advantages and limitations of each treatment option, as well as realistic timelines, costs, and expected outcomes. Family, general, and cosmetic dentists take into account oral habits, existing dental work, and lifestyle considerations to recommend the most suitable approach.
The goal of the consultation is to build a collaborative treatment plan that reflects both functional needs and cosmetic desires. Whether the treatment involves a single procedure or a comprehensive smile makeover, the process is transparent, comfortable, and aligned with the patient’s long-term vision. This initial visit also provides an opportunity to address any questions or concerns and to establish a supportive, trust-based relationship between the patient and dentist.
